Authentication is the cornerstone of secure and efficient access to any platform. It ensures that only authorized users can access resources, thereby safeguarding data and workflows. In the context of High-Performance Computing (HPC), Artificial Intelligence (AI), and Virtual Desktop Infrastructure (VDI), secure authentication is even more critical due to the sensitivity of data and computational resources involved. SyncHPC, a hybrid platform for running HPC, AI, and VDI workloads, integrates various authentication methods to meet diverse organizational needs. Its pluggable architecture allows seamless integration of multiple authentication types, providing flexibility and enhanced security for users.
Identity Providers in SyncHPC
Identity providers (IdPs) are services that verify a user’s identity and enable secure access to applications and resources. By centralizing authentication, IdPs streamline access management, improve security, and provide a better user experience. SyncHPC integrates with several leading identity providers to cater to diverse organizational needs.
Single Sign-On (SSO): Single Sign-On allows users to log in once and gain access to multiple applications and services without re-entering credentials. This improves user convenience and reduces password fatigue, all while maintaining robust security. SyncHPC supports SSO through protocols like SAML and OpenID Connect, ensuring a seamless and secure login experience across workflows.
Linux NIS: The Network Information Service (NIS) is a traditional identity provider commonly used in Linux environments. It simplifies the management of user credentials and permissions across a network. While NIS is valuable for legacy systems, SyncHPC also provides modern alternatives like Okta and Azure AD, ensuring compatibility and flexibility for diverse organizational setups.
Okta: Okta is a leading Identity-as-a-Service (IDaaS) provider offering adaptive multi-factor authentication (MFA), user lifecycle management, and seamless SSO. Its cloud-based architecture makes it a versatile choice for organizations embracing modern identity management. SyncHPC integrates Okta effortlessly, enabling secure access and streamlined management for hybrid workloads.
Azure Active Directory (Azure AD): Azure AD is a cloud-based identity provider that offers enterprise-grade access management and security. Deeply integrated with Microsoft’s ecosystem, Azure AD provides features like conditional access, MFA, and device compliance policies. SyncHPC supports Azure AD integration, making it an ideal choice for enterprises heavily invested in Microsoft technologies. This integration allows businesses to leverage advanced identity management capabilities for their HPC, AI, and VDI workloads.
Types of Authentication Integrated with SyncHPC
SyncHPC supports multiple authentication methods, providing flexibility and enhanced security for organizations. Below are the supported types of authentication and their ease of integration:
Password Authentication (PAM)
- Overview: SyncHPC’s own pluggable authentication module (PAM) ensures basic but robust user verification for those without external integrations.
- Ease of Integration: Built-in PAM authentication requires minimal setup, making it a default choice for simple configurations.
LDAP Authentication
- Overview: A centralized authentication system that enables organizations to manage user access across multiple systems efficiently.
- Configuration Parameters: Enterprise Active Directory (AD) Server and Enterprise Domain Name.
- Ease of Integration: Specify the AD server address and domain name, and SyncHPC automatically manages user and group synchronization.
AzureAD Authentication
- Overview: A cloud-based identity and access management service from Microsoft, perfect for businesses leveraging Azure infrastructure.
- Configuration Parameters: Client AD, Authority, Redirect URI, Cache Location, Store Auth State in Cookie, Protected Resource Map, AzureAD Metadata Endpoint, AzureAD Client Secret, and AzureAD Tenant ID.
- Ease of Integration: Simply provide these configuration details, and SyncHPC connects to AzureAD to enable seamless SSO and secure user access.
Okta Authentication
- Overview: A widely used Identity-as-a-Service (IDaaS) solution, offering single sign-on (SSO) and adaptive multi-factor authentication (MFA).
- Configuration Parameters: Issuer, Client ID, Redirect URI, Scopes, and OKTA Metadata Endpoint.
- Ease of Integration: Add the issuer and metadata endpoint, and
OpenID Authentication
- Overview: An open standard for decentralized authentication that simplifies user access while maintaining security.
- Ease of Integration: OpenID settings are minimal, requiring basic configuration for decentralized authentication.
SAML Authentication
- Overview: A protocol that enables SSO by securely transmitting authentication data between an identity provider and a service provider.
- Configuration Parameters: Metadata URL and Issuer.
- Ease of Integration: Enter the metadata URL and issuer details to enable SAML authentication for secure and federated access.
Benefits of Authentication in SyncHPC
- Enhanced Security: Protects sensitive data and computational resources from unauthorized access.
- User Convenience: Single sign-on (SSO) methods reduce the need for multiple login credentials.
- Scalability: Accommodates large-scale user bases with centralized and automated authentication processes.
- Flexibility: Offers a wide range of authentication integrations tailored to organizational requirements.
- Regulatory Compliance: Helps organizations meet stringent data protection and compliance standards.
- Improved Collaboration: Centralized authentication facilitates seamless collaboration among diverse teams, including data scientists, engineers, and HPC users.
Conclusion:
In a world where data and computational power drive innovation, ensuring secure and seamless access is paramount. SyncHPC addresses this need by offering a robust authentication framework that supports various authentication methods. This flexibility and security make SyncHPC a reliable platform for organizations striving to integrate HPC, AI, and VDI workloads into their operational workflows. With SyncHPC, businesses can confidently focus on their analytical and computational goals, knowing their access systems are secure, efficient, and scalable.
Leave a comment